Job Summary

The Maintenance Technician - Level 3 is a multi‑craft position responsible for maintaining production equipment and machinery in proper operating order through preventative maintenance, basic troubleshooting, and basic repair. This role works closely with Operations to ensure reliable equipment performance and minimal downtime. The technician participates in improvement activities and supports the implementation of Total Preventative Maintenance (TPM) and machine ownership initiatives.

This position requires strong technical skills, teamwork, and adherence to all safety and quality standards within a manufacturing environment.

Responsibilities Functional Operations
  • Works closely with the Operations teams to maintain PECNA equipment
  • Checks settings, gauge readings, Human Machine Interface (HMI), and sensors regularly to keep machines operating at specifications
  • Performs regular preventative maintenance per documented requirements (e.g., cleaning, lubricating shafts, bearings, gears)
  • Tightens bolts, inspects belts/chains for wear and tension, changes belts, filters, and other replaceable parts as needed
  • Greases or lubricates fittings, joints, unions, and motors as required
  • Performs complex cleaning activities on dismantled equipment and reassembles per OEM specifications
  • Cleans, organizes, inventories, stocks, and maintains shop and production areas, parts, tools, and supplies in a 6S environment
  • Operates and maintains tools and equipment in assigned areas
  • Capable of working all scheduled shifts
Performance Optimization & Continuous Improvement
  • Performs basic troubleshooting to replace worn or broken parts
  • Conducts visual and audible observations to detect abnormalities and schedule repairs
  • Examines machine parts to detect wear and imperfections
  • Performs basic electrical or mechanical troubleshooting to determine problems in non‑functioning electro‑mechanical equipment
  • Uses hand/power tools, electric meters, measuring devices, and material handling equipment
  • Identifies faulty operations and defective material; escalates issues to supervisors
  • Conducts initial multimeter readings of motors and reads PLC ladder logic
  • Identifies causes of unexpected breakdowns and actively works to eliminate them
  • Assists in developing new Standard Work when required
Training & Team Support
  • Able to train others at the same or lower level
Cross‑Functional Collaboration & Communication
  • Collaborates with cross‑functional teams to resolve issues promptly
  • Supports implementation of industry‑standard compliant processes and procedures
Quality, Safety, & Compliance
  • Maintains accurate records of completed work, including After Action Reviews (AAR)
  • Ensures compliance with all safety regulations, standard operating procedures, and company quality policies
  • Follows 6S workplace organization standards and maintains a clean, safe, and well‑organized work area
  • Adheres to all Lockout/Tagout (LOTO) and personal protective equipment (PPE) requirements
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) Requirements
  • To ensure health and safety in the workplace and for employee protection, wearing PPE is a possibility and includes equipment such as a full Tyvek suit, safety shoes, gloves, safety glasses, face mask, and a full hazmat suit that includes a respirator. A respirator fit test will be required based on functional area.
